Food Safety
About the Program
The Food Safety Program provides a number of services to ensure the proper handling and distribution of food served to the general public. This includes:
- Conducting inspections of restaurants, festival food booths, and mobile food vehicles
- Conducting investigations of foodborne illness complaints and outbreaks
- Providing Food Safety Education (learn about available classes)

File an Illness Complaint
To file an illness complaint, please call or email the Communicable Disease Unit. Note that illness complaints require completion of an illness intake questionnaire, including a three-day food history.
